Duk Jun Yu is a scholar working on Plant Science, Molecular Biology and Global and Planetary Change. According to data from OpenAlex, Duk Jun Yu has authored 21 papers receiving a total of 439 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Plant Science, 7 papers in Molecular Biology and 3 papers in Global and Planetary Change. Recurrent topics in Duk Jun Yu’s work include Plant Physiology and Cultivation Studies (12 papers), Postharvest Quality and Shelf Life Management (8 papers) and Horticultural and Viticultural Research (7 papers). Duk Jun Yu is often cited by papers focused on Plant Physiology and Cultivation Studies (12 papers), Postharvest Quality and Shelf Life Management (8 papers) and Horticultural and Viticultural Research (7 papers). Duk Jun Yu collaborates with scholars based in South Korea and United States. Duk Jun Yu's co-authors include Hee Jae Lee, Sun Woo Chung, Su Jin Kim, Junhyung Park, Hyungmin Rho, Jin Hoe Huh, Jung Hyun Kwon, Erik S. Runkle, Ki Sun Kim and Eun Young Nam and has published in prestigious journals such as PLoS ONE, Food Chemistry and Scientia Horticulturae.
